Chrysler was the last holdout for left-handed threads and finally got rid of them in the mid-60's. Right side lugs were right-handed and left side were left-handed. The wheel studs were stamped with R & L, but not the lug nuts. They were a source of great irritation to young mechanics (and their bosses) who couldn't get them loosened, or cross-threaded a right handed lug nut on a left handed stud. Righty tighty....lefty loosey didn't apply to them.Modern cars now have 4 or 5 lug nuts and with the implementation of very fine threads, you don't need left handed threading.
